Same Ticket Tomorrow
Ticket #7741 was closed yesterday. It is waiting in your queue again tonight.
Same Ticket Tomorrow is a free archival mystery about proving which version of a record deserves to survive. Review tickets, immutable receipts, policy signatures, physical logs, and personnel records. Cite the smallest sufficient evidence pair, prove eight deductions, then decide whether each recurrence should be merged, escalated, or deleted.

The game runs in the browser and requires no account, download, file upload, or access to real email. All records and people are fictional.

CONTENT WARNING
Psychological workplace horror, identity distortion, implied death and disappearance, and institutional manipulation. No gore or jump scares.
DEVELOPMENT DISCLOSURE
AI-assisted development was used for portions of code, writing, and vector-asset production. The integrated narrative, puzzle logic, interface, assets, and release build were reviewed and tested as one authored game by High Player.
